How Time Calculations Work
Time arithmetic differs from standard math because it uses a base-60 system (60 minutes per hour, 60 seconds per minute). Adding 2 hours 45 minutes to 3 hours 30 minutes gives 6 hours 15 minutes, not 5 hours 75 minutes. Practical Applications
Freelancers and employees use time calculators to track billable hours and calculate payroll. Travelers use them to figure out arrival times across time zones. Fitness enthusiasts track workout durations. Event planners calculate setup, event, and teardown times. Project managers estimate task completion times. The decimal hours format (e.g., 6.25 hours instead of 6 hours 15 minutes) is particularly useful for invoicing and payroll systems that require decimal time entries.
Tips for Time Management
Accurate time tracking is the foundation of effective time management. Studies show that most people underestimate how long tasks take by 25-50%, a phenomenon known as the planning fallacy.
